The NHL draft fast approaching (June 22-23 in Columbus), the Bruins have invited a handful of top prospects to the Hub of Hockey this weekend.

‘‘We’ll put them through some tests, take them to dinner, show them the city,’’ said Bruins general manager Peter Chiarelli, who returned to Boston Wednesday after attending the NHL combine in Toronto and then chairing his club’s scouting meets in Ottawa.
